Why your emails don't get replies

Before you blame your copy, check your placement. An email sitting in spam can't be replied to — deliverability is the silent reply-rate killer.

Teams obsess over subject lines and CTAs, but the first question should be: is the email even being seen? Poor inbox placement caps your reply rate no matter how good the writing is.

Placement first, then persuasion

Run an inbox-placement test. If your mail is landing in Promotions or Spam, fix that before touching your copy — it's the highest-leverage change you can make.

Once you're reliably in the inbox, then optimize targeting, personalization and your call to action. Good copy on delivered mail is what earns replies.

How do I know if deliverability is my problem?

Run a placement test to a few seed accounts across providers. If you're not consistently in Primary/Inbox, deliverability is capping your replies.
